Cash Kings Jay-Z and Kanye West are successful for a reason — they craft clever, time-tested rhymes, strike a chord with their genre-spanning tunes and whip up stunning visuals to accompany their catalog of hits. Can we expect the Spike Jonze-directed clip for Watch The Throne jam “Otis” to fit that bill? MTV has unleashed a short preview of the vid ahead of its premiere tomorrow evening. Head below to watch Jay and ‘Ye try a little tenderness. A lot flashes by in the mere seconds we’re given as a scrap ahead of the main course that is “Otis”: black-and-white footage of the two MCs grooving in the lab, an explosion, the pair walking arm-in-arm off a stage, Kanye shouting while flames surround him, Jay walking up to Yeezy as fireworks shoot into the sky and the rhyming twosome goofing around in front of the ever-present American flag that surrounds this single.

The full “Otis” video debuts on MTV and MTV.com tomorrow (August 11) at 8:56 p.m.
